What is the Mirae Asset Mutual Fund Application Form?
The Mirae Asset Mutual Fund Application Form is designed to facilitate investments in mutual funds managed by Mirae Asset. This form is crucial for investors as it helps them apply for units in various funds and ensures compliance with India's KYC (Know Your Customer) regulations.
Investors must provide personal documentation when filling out the form, making it essential for secure investment practices and proper record-keeping.
Purpose and Benefits of the Mirae Asset Mutual Fund Application Form
This application form serves several important functions for prospective investors. Primarily, it allows individuals to invest in mutual funds offered by Mirae Asset, supporting investment methods such as lumpsum payments and systematic investment plans (SIPs).
Another key benefit is the ability to designate nominees, ensuring that designated beneficiaries receive the investment proceeds in the event of unforeseen circumstances.
Who Needs the Mirae Asset Mutual Fund Application Form?
The application form is necessary for a diverse range of users. It is typically used by applicants, guardians, and authorized signatories who need to ensure investments are managed well.
Particularly for Non-Resident Indians (NRIs), it is essential to provide additional documentation alongside the form, as they have specific compliance requirements to meet.
In many cases, the form is mandatory to complete transactions related to mutual fund investments.

Field-by-Field Instructions for the Mirae Asset Mutual Fund Application Form
Each section of the Mirae Asset Mutual Fund Application Form has specific fields that require careful attention:
-
Name & Broker Code: Fill in your full name and the broker code assigned to your investment account.
-
Investment Preferences: Indicate your choice between lumpsum investment and SIP.
-
Signature Lines: Ensure that applicants and guardians provide their signatures where required.
-
Error Checking: Be mindful of common mistakes, such as incorrect PAN entries, which can delay processing.

Who is eligible to use the Mirae Asset Mutual Fund Application Form?
The form can be used by individual investors, guardians of minors, and authorized signatories for corporate entities looking to invest in Mirae Asset mutual funds. NRIs need to ensure compliance with additional documentation.
Are there any deadlines for submitting this application?
While specific deadlines can depend on the mutual fund’s promotional time frames, it’s advisable to submit the application as soon as your investment decision is made to start benefitting from market opportunities.
What supporting documents are required with this application?
Commonly required documents include valid identification proof, PAN details for KYC compliance, bank account statements, and any additional documentation as specified for NRIs to validate the source of funds.

What are some common mistakes to avoid when filling out this form?
Always double-check that all required fields are filled accurately, especially KYC information and signatures. Common errors include incomplete PAN details or missing signature fields which can delay processing.
How long does processing the application take?
Processing times can vary but generally take a few business days, depending on the completeness of the application and supporting documents provided. Always check with Mirae Asset for specific timelines.
Is notarization required for this form?
No, there is no requirement for notarizing the Mirae Asset Mutual Fund Application Form. Ensure all information is accurate, as notarization is not a standard step for the application process.
